Cheese & Rice Casserole Ada Recipe
Recipe Ingredients:
2 1/2 cups Brown rice, cooked 3 Green onions, chopped 1 cup Lowfat cottage cheese 1 tsp Dried dill 1/4 cup Parmesan cheese, Grated 1/2 cup Lowfat milk
Recipe Instructions:
Combine all ingredients in a mixing bowl. Pour into a lightly oiled casserole. Bake at 350 F for 15 to 20 minutes.
From the ADA Holiday Cookbook by Dr. Betty Wedman.
one serving = 2 bread exchanges + 1 lean meat + 1/2 milk exchange = 235 cal, 35 CHO, 14 PRO, 4 fat, 682 Na, 203 K, 10 Cholest Posted by PHILLIP BOWER, Prodigy ID# FHMN87A.
Servings: 4
